    Biotin + Multivitamin question

    Hi everyone, new member here, ready to begin the fitness journey. I plan to start slowly and progressively increase every aspect (training, nutrition, supplements, gear, etc).
    I believe this question has already been answered but I couldn´t find it even with the Advanced search.


    I have started to take a multivitamin supplement, just to make sure I cover the basics, and a biotin supplement (for the hair loss, eventually, I´ll become Jason Statham, jk). I am taking Now Foods Adam multivitamin and Natrol Bioting 10,000mg. I chose them because of the very positive reviews.

    I read that B supplements give you an energy boost and is better to take them in the morning. However, label says to take them with a meal. I usually skip breakfast and wouldn´t want to take the supplements at work for lunch.

    I would want to take both supplements at night. Has anyone an opinion on this? experience with supplements at night?

    multivitamins contain fat soluble vitamins which is why it is recommended to take with a meal, B vitamins are water soluble an can be taken on an empty stomach
